A Practical Essay On Stricture Of The Rectum is a medical book written by Frederick Salmon in 1828. The book provides a comprehensive examination of rectal strictures, including their causes, symptoms, and treatment options. Salmon draws on his extensive experience as a surgeon to provide practical advice for physicians who may encounter patients with rectal strictures. The book covers topics such as the use of enemas, the surgical treatment of strictures, and the importance of proper diet and exercise in managing the condition. The writing style is clear and concise, making the book accessible to both medical professionals and lay readers.
